This project aims to study the diversity and ecological roles of marine stramenopiles, a group of small flagellated eukaryotes. It will analyze their abundance, grazing activity, and genomic structure to understand their significance in marine ecosystems.
Most of the biodiversity in oceans is constituted by microbes which dominate the biomass and have key roles in ecosystem functioning and biogeochemical cycling.
Recent culture-independent studies of marine planktonic protists have unveiled a large diversity at all phylogenetic scale, notably among the heterotrophic microeukaryotes compartment (2-5 µm cell size), and the existence of novel groups.
